项目场景: 这几天在安装AndroidStudio的时候遇到了很多问题,特此做一个分享,希望对大家有所帮助,以下是我遇到的问题:Android版本不对,后换到我上周安装的版本才可以gradle下载不了,很慢AndroidStudio报错:Connectiontimedout:connectIfyouarebehindanHTTPproxySDK包java安装问题描述与分析&解决方案 Android版本不对,后换到我上周安装的版本才可以如下是我自己的版本,分享给大家: 链接:https://pan.baidu.com/s/1y9lPHfukSR-RUFXhtN
问题:WerecommendusinganewerAndroidGradleplugintousecompileSdk=34ThisAndroidGradleplugin(8.0.2)wastesteduptocompileSdk=33.YouarestronglyencouragedtoupdateyourprojecttouseanewerAndroidGradlepluginthathasbeentestedwithcompileSdk=34.IfyouarealreadyusingthelatestversionoftheAndroidGradleplugin,youmayneedto
是否有一种在AndroidStudio中构建、安装和自动启动自定义Gradle构建的简单方法?当我在AndroidStudio中按下“播放”(运行)按钮(具有典型的Android项目配置)时,我的项目会构建,将其安装在适当的设备上,然后启动应用。如何使用特定的构建/产品风格(使用Gradle)执行此操作?我已经创建了运行任务“installFlavor1”的Gradle配置。这安装正确,但它不会自动启动应用程序。 最佳答案 您始终可以从AndroidStudio的buildVariant窗口中选择不同的buildVariant。然后
我有一个具有以下结构的现有Android项目:-ProjectName--AndroidManifest.xml--local.properties--project.properties--assets--libs(containingalljars)--modules(containingalllibraryprojectsmyprojectdependson)--res--src----com/namespace/projectname(allmyclassesincludingmainactivityarehere)除了AndroidStudioIDE默认提供的系统之外,我没有
当我在AndroidStudio中打开我的项目时,我总是得到这个。当AndroidStudio刚出来的时候,我经历了thisprocess所以项目应该有Gradle构建系统。在项目的根目录下有一个build.gradle文件。我仍然可以构建和运行该项目,但我不明白为什么它总是这样说,因为该项目应该使用gradle构建系统。任何帮助都会很棒。 最佳答案 androidstudio支持两种“构建模式”。一种是“遗留”,一种是“基于梯度”。如果您使用的是非常早期的androidstudio版本,您可能仍在使用旧版构建模式。您需要使用“gr
简表:有哪些组织AAR的代码/POM的方法,这样使用该AAR的应用程序只有它们实际需要的依赖项?长表:假设我们有一个依赖于打包为AAR(L)的Android库项目的应用程序。L包含多个类,任何给定的应用程序(如A)只会使用这些类的子集。例如:L可能包含FragmentnativeAPI级别11fragment、反向移植fragment和ActionBarSherlock风格fragment的实现L可能包含Activity常规Activity的实现,FragmentActivity,ActionBarActivity,和ActionBarSherlock风格的ActivityL可以通过L
我已经安装了Androidstudio3.0.1,然后尝试通过选择一个空Activity来构建第一个应用程序,但我收到了这条消息:Gradleprojectsyncfailed.Basicfunctionality(e.g.editing,debugging)willnotworkproperly错误信息如下:Unabletoresolvedependencyfor':app@releaseUnitTest/compileClasspath':Couldnotresolvecom.android.support:appcompat-v7:26.1.0.Couldnotresolveco
我正在尝试将JavaCV与AndroidStudio和Gradle结合使用。我写了这样的代码fragment:repositories{mavenCentral()maven{url"http://maven2.javacv.googlecode.com/git/"}}dependencies{compilefiles('libs/android-support-v4.jar')compilegroup:'com.googlecode.javacpp',name:'javacpp',version:'0.5'compilegroup:'com.googlecode.javacv',na
最近我开始了解Gradle作为构建系统的强大功能,作为一名Android开发人员,我想深入了解它。Onearticle说了以下内容:YoucanexecuteallthebuildtasksavailabletoyourAndroidprojectusingtheGradlewrappercommandlinetool.It'savailableasabatchfileforWindows(gradlew.bat)andashellscriptforLinuxandMac(gradlew.sh),andit'saccessiblefromtherootofeachprojectyouc
在我的AndroidGradle构建中,我需要访问我从.bash.profile设置的环境变量。当我从命令行构建时它工作正常-Gradle脚本可以看到所有变量。但是,当我尝试从AndroidStudio运行我的构建时-我不再有我的环境变量。这是我所面临的粗略描述:1)通过~/.bash.profile设置自定义环境变量:exportMY_CUSTOM_VAR='HelloWorld'2)在build.gradle中创建打印此环境变量的任务:taskprintVar3)从命令行执行printVar。输出正确-环境变量已设置:输出:HelloWorld4)从AndroidStudio执行p